(1) Does MKVNIXGUI work in batch mode?
(2) Is there a free piece of software that takes subtitles out of multiple files??

Mkvtoolnix GUI can do it. Open preferences->Multiplexer->Enabling tracks and set it to only enable video+audio. Then preferences->Multiplexer: "When dropping files": "Create one new [...] for each file". Then drag&drop all files onto the GUI, "Multiplexer"->"Actions for all tabs"->"Start multiplexing".
(In preferences->Multiplexer->Output you can find options for output folder/file names.) -
"Create one new [...] for each file" = Several files (one output file for every input file)
